For thousands of years Jewish children have kept Passover. Some baby foods are Kp such as all Beachnut fruits. Check the Internet to find out.
If you have questions, check with your rabbis. Gates of Mitzvah, Kosher for Passover cookbooks including the one by our Sisterhood , talking with observant Reform Jews and reading other resources will help you make Passover real and meaningful for yourself and those around you.
We strive to create Jewish homes, not just Jews. We are blessed to have many non-Jews raising wonderful Jewish families at great sacrifice. In the home, it is special for non-Jewish parents to be Passover role models for children. Over and over again, my students appreciate the parents who keep Passover with them. If you decide to break Passover for a vacation, make it clear that this is a personal choice, not a Jewish choice. I will be around March 10 th and 17 th to help members with Haggadah choices and to answer Passover questions.
For me, it is not about being judgmental or dogmatic. For the College Student: When you visit colleges in the spring, ask about the Jewish life and what is done for Passover. For the Jewish Home — Priorities for Passover Observance as a Reform Jew: 1 Attend a real Sede r it is not just a family dinner… a haggadah service should be present for it to feel like Passover…even with young children you can find haggadahs and read books with them about Passover or better yet, Make your own seder.
